Rancher开源版本,能纳管多pod资源

Rancher Server 设置

  • Rancher 版本:2.6.5
  • 安装选项 (Docker install/Helm Chart): docker
    • 如果是 Helm Chart 安装,需要提供 Local 集群的类型(RKE1, RKE2, k3s, EKS, 等)和版本:
  • 在线或离线部署:离线

下游集群信息

  • Kubernetes 版本: 不限定
  • Cluster Type (Local/Downstream):
    • 如果 Downstream,是什么类型的集群?(自定义/导入或为托管 等): 导入

问题描述

  1. 我现在部署了rancher2.6.5的服务,导入管理了一个集群是大概有4000个pod。现在发现打开dashboard这个ui界面特别卡。想了解,社区版本的rancher,对集群管理pod和node节点,超过多少会有明显压力。

UI的渲染压力取决于:当前访问用户的权限、namespace数量、workload/pod数量、secret/configmap数据规模等等。

对于前端的性能优化,可以关注 label area/performancehttps://github.com/rancher/dashboard/issues?q=is%3Aissue+label%3Aarea%2Fperformance

对于后端的性能优化,可以关注 label area/scalabilityIssues · rancher/rancher · GitHub

目前还没有根据集群规模来系统性测试UI渲染时间,不过,从目前已有的用户反馈看,只要不使用admin用户访问全量数据,UI不会有特别大的压力。

当然,即使是admin用户访问方式,也一直优化的方向。在下一个版本2.6.7会有一些UI性能优化,不过很难确定是否匹配你的场景。